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
336650884 33478828997 689 434457 04
767303 45974287617 48
767303 45974287617 48
51594715 71 881384 59733975496
All about undefined
Interested in learning more?
767303 45974287617 48
51594715 71 881384 59733975496
See more
23080914 12
9430471875 013 737146927
See more
99066633 6280612916 886838
91513 915 5084047668
See more